diff --git a/maven-core/src/site/apt/default-bindings.apt b/maven-core/src/site/apt/default-bindings.apt deleted file mode 100644 index 47acbe75c3..0000000000 --- a/maven-core/src/site/apt/default-bindings.apt +++ /dev/null @@ -1,51 +0,0 @@ - --- - Bindings for Default Lifecycle Reference - --- - Hervé Boutemy - --- - 2011-09-12 - --- - -Bindings for <<>> Lifecycle Reference - - The {{{./lifecycles.html}default lifecycle}} is defined without any binding: bindings are defined separately and - are specific for each packaging: - -%{toc|fromDepth=2} - -* Bindings for <<>> packaging - -%{snippet|id=pom-lifecycle|file=src/main/resources/META-INF/plexus/artifact-handlers.xml} - -* Bindings for <<>> packaging - -%{snippet|id=jar-lifecycle|file=src/main/resources/META-INF/plexus/artifact-handlers.xml} - -* Bindings for <<>> packaging - -%{snippet|id=ejb-lifecycle|file=src/main/resources/META-INF/plexus/artifact-handlers.xml} - -* Bindings for <<>> packaging - -%{snippet|id=ejb3-lifecycle|file=src/main/resources/META-INF/plexus/artifact-handlers.xml} - -* Bindings for <<>> packaging - -%{snippet|id=maven-plugin-lifecycle|file=src/main/resources/META-INF/plexus/artifact-handlers.xml} - -* Bindings for <<>> packaging - -%{snippet|id=war-lifecycle|file=src/main/resources/META-INF/plexus/artifact-handlers.xml} - -* Bindings for <<>> packaging - -%{snippet|id=ear-lifecycle|file=src/main/resources/META-INF/plexus/artifact-handlers.xml} - -* Bindings for <<>> packaging - -%{snippet|id=rar-lifecycle|file=src/main/resources/META-INF/plexus/artifact-handlers.xml} - -* Bindings for <<>> packaging - -%{snippet|id=par-lifecycle|file=src/main/resources/META-INF/plexus/artifact-handlers.xml} - \ No newline at end of file diff --git a/maven-core/src/site/apt/default-bindings.apt.vm b/maven-core/src/site/apt/default-bindings.apt.vm new file mode 100644 index 0000000000..0e129ba49f --- /dev/null +++ b/maven-core/src/site/apt/default-bindings.apt.vm @@ -0,0 +1,51 @@ + --- + Bindings for Default Lifecycle Reference + --- + Hervé Boutemy + --- + 2011-09-12 + --- + +Bindings for <<>> Lifecycle Reference + + The {{{./lifecycles.html}default lifecycle}} is defined without any binding: bindings are defined separately and + are specific for each packaging: + +%{toc|fromDepth=2} + +* Bindings for <<>> packaging + +%{snippet|id=pom-lifecycle|file=${project.basedir}/src/main/resources/META-INF/plexus/artifact-handlers.xml} + +* Bindings for <<>> packaging + +%{snippet|id=jar-lifecycle|file=${project.basedir}/src/main/resources/META-INF/plexus/artifact-handlers.xml} + +* Bindings for <<>> packaging + +%{snippet|id=ejb-lifecycle|file=${project.basedir}/src/main/resources/META-INF/plexus/artifact-handlers.xml} + +* Bindings for <<>> packaging + +%{snippet|id=ejb3-lifecycle|file=${project.basedir}/src/main/resources/META-INF/plexus/artifact-handlers.xml} + +* Bindings for <<>> packaging + +%{snippet|id=maven-plugin-lifecycle|file=${project.basedir}/src/main/resources/META-INF/plexus/artifact-handlers.xml} + +* Bindings for <<>> packaging + +%{snippet|id=war-lifecycle|file=${project.basedir}/src/main/resources/META-INF/plexus/artifact-handlers.xml} + +* Bindings for <<>> packaging + +%{snippet|id=ear-lifecycle|file=${project.basedir}/src/main/resources/META-INF/plexus/artifact-handlers.xml} + +* Bindings for <<>> packaging + +%{snippet|id=rar-lifecycle|file=${project.basedir}/src/main/resources/META-INF/plexus/artifact-handlers.xml} + +* Bindings for <<>> packaging + +%{snippet|id=par-lifecycle|file=${project.basedir}/src/main/resources/META-INF/plexus/artifact-handlers.xml} + \ No newline at end of file diff --git a/maven-core/src/site/apt/lifecycles.apt b/maven-core/src/site/apt/lifecycles.apt.vm similarity index 63% rename from maven-core/src/site/apt/lifecycles.apt rename to maven-core/src/site/apt/lifecycles.apt.vm index f9b2d5acfd..253bbf6a75 100644 --- a/maven-core/src/site/apt/lifecycles.apt +++ b/maven-core/src/site/apt/lifecycles.apt.vm @@ -17,16 +17,16 @@ Lifecycles Reference <<>> lifecycle is defined without any associated. Bindings are {{{./default-bindings.html}defined separately for every packaging}}: -%{snippet|id=lifecycle|file=src/main/resources/META-INF/plexus/components.xml} +%{snippet|id=lifecycle|file=${project.basedir}/src/main/resources/META-INF/plexus/components.xml} * <<>> Lifecycle <<>> lifecycle is defined directly with its bindings. -%{snippet|id=clean|file=src/main/resources/META-INF/plexus/components.xml} +%{snippet|id=clean|file=${project.basedir}/src/main/resources/META-INF/plexus/components.xml} * <<>> Lifecycle <<>> lifecycle is defined directly with its bindings. -%{snippet|id=site|file=src/main/resources/META-INF/plexus/components.xml} +%{snippet|id=site|file=${project.basedir}/src/main/resources/META-INF/plexus/components.xml} diff --git a/maven-model-builder/src/site/apt/super-pom.apt b/maven-model-builder/src/site/apt/super-pom.apt.vm similarity index 53% rename from maven-model-builder/src/site/apt/super-pom.apt rename to maven-model-builder/src/site/apt/super-pom.apt.vm index 56625f6ae8..df2a6f9c06 100644 --- a/maven-model-builder/src/site/apt/super-pom.apt +++ b/maven-model-builder/src/site/apt/super-pom.apt.vm @@ -10,4 +10,4 @@ Super POM All models implicitly inherit from a super-POM: -%{snippet|id=superpom|file=src/main/resources/org/apache/maven/model/pom-4.0.0.xml} +%{snippet|id=superpom|file=${project.build.sourceDirectory}/../resources/org/apache/maven/model/pom-4.0.0.xml}